1. Quick‑Start Overview

The Big Bass Bonanza is a 5‑reel, 3‑row video slot with ten fixed paylines. You don’t have to chase wilds or scatter combos; the reels spin, align symbols left‑to‑right, and if you hit three or more matching icons you win instantly.

Key numbers for a quick player:

  • Base bet ranges from €0.10 to €250.
  • RTP sits around 96.71%.
  • Maximum win 2,100x your stake.
  • Volatility is medium‑high – wins are rare but can be big.
  • Free spins award up to 20 rounds if you land five scatters.

5. Free Spins Trigger – Quick Wins Await

Landing three hooked‑fish scatters grants ten free spins; four scatters give fifteen; five scatters unlocks twenty free spins—a clear incentive to go all in quickly.

The fisherman (wild) appears only during free spins and substitutes for all symbols except scatters. This means that a single fisherman can instantly create a winning line across multiple reels.

6. Money Symbols & Progressive Multiplier – The Money Machine

When you’re inside free spins, fish symbols turn into money symbols with random cash values. Each time a fisherman lands during free spins it collects all current money symbol values and adds one to a meter above the reels.

The multiplier system kicks in: every fourth fisherman collected triggers a retrigger, adding ten more free spins and boosting the multiplier—first retrigger doubles payouts (2x), second treble (3x), third reaches tenfold (10x). The last retrigger also grants an extra multiplier increase for subsequent fish values.

7. Dynamite Feature – Unexpected Boosts

The Dynamite feature only activates during free spins when a fisherman lands but no fish appear on the reels. It randomly drops fish symbols into play, creating new winning opportunities.
